Bees Baseball Run-Rules Red Boiling Springs
The Upperman Bees Baseball team put together a dominant outing on Wednesday with a 16-1 win over Red Boiling Springs.
Trailing 1-0 in the bottom of the first, the Bees wasted little time in taking control of the game and scored eight runs to take an 8-1 lead into the second inning.
They added three runs in the third, and five more in the fourth to push the lead to its final margin of 16-1.
Elliot Lee and Tyler Jared each drove in two runs on two hits for the Bees, while Eric Farley, Brady LeFever, Eli Huddleston and Carter Shanks each drove in a run apiece.
On the mound, Drew Davidson tossed a complete game of five innings pitched with six strikeouts and he only gave up a single run on one hit.
